its not as strong. because no unblockables and you have to know which wake up they will do to take full advantage

in ae2012 you jump and either throw the kunai or go for an unblockable no matter what. you dont care what the opponents options are because ibuki naturally covers everything and is safe

in ultra you have to read what the opponent is doing

if i wake up normal, i only have to deal with whatever frame kill you chose which leads to a more predictable block

if you commit to the kunai to cover normal timing and give yourself a better mix up, you eat a full punish if i did DWU

theres also the issue of the kunai mix up to cover DWU not being a true 50/50. if youre reacting to the tech message, then you arent going to have the same variable release timing you can make in ae2012

so its there, but the opponent has a higher chance of escaping or blocking, and if they make the right choice on when to DWU they can even get a punish
